Output e33aaf28f2c68b5fb8f2993cd2bc3aafd9e0c95cd8bee8f28623a7afaca47192:0

value
6673800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0eec18b0d85e91882ccf9dea585999eea1b36be OP_EQUALVERIFY OP_CHECKSIG
address
1MWLP2ioQoJT4TPkzdiprFE83VPpLMmFEC
transaction
e33aaf28f2c68b5fb8f2993cd2bc3aafd9e0c95cd8bee8f28623a7afaca47192
spent
true